Unethical adjective - Not conforming to a high moral standard; morally unacceptable.
Usage example: unethical treatment of prisoners of war that was a clear violation of international law
Dissolute and unethical are semantically related. Sometimes you can use "Dissolute" instead an adjective "Unethical".
